## Authentication

Welcome aboard! The thumbnail generation queue (we call it Thumbler) sits behind the Pinwick gateway, and every request needs an API key — no anonymous access, even from inside the VPN. Workers pull jobs off the queue, render thumbnails, and post results back to the asset service, all using the same credential. For local dev, point your `.env` at the staging gateway so you don't touch production assets. The staging key for the internal Thumbler API is below.

service key, fawip-bajef: kto11_Qt5wZK9vdNC

**Vendor note: Inkmill markdown pipeline**

Rendering for Parchway docs is outsourced to Inkmill under an annual contract, renewing each March. They handle sanitization and PDF export; we own the upload queue. SLA: 4-hour response on rendering failures. Escalate only after two failed retries. Their support desk is reachable at the address below.

billing contact of hahaf-baguf = zorael.tammir.jorius@sivrelhq.internal

Subject: Transition to annual billing

Executive team,

Starting next quarter, Bramleyfield Software moves all new contracts to annual upfront billing. Monthly plans remain only for legacy Quillbase accounts through year-end. Finance projects a meaningful cash-flow improvement and lower collection costs. Department heads should brief their teams before the customer announcement on the 14th. The strategic context for this change is noted below.

internal memo for kawip-hadug: Headcount on the Wenwyn team goes from 7 to 140 by the end of January. Gross margin on Wenwyn came in at 20 percent against a plan of 15 percent.

## 4.2.0 — Changed defaults

Lintbarrow now regenerates the static-analysis baseline file on every merge to main instead of only on tagged releases. Suppressions older than 90 days are pruned automatically; previously they lived forever. New findings against a stale baseline fail the build rather than warn. Reviewers: expect baseline diffs in most PRs this cycle — that's intentional, not noise. Opt-outs exist per-repo but require a justification string. The defaults shipping with 4.2.0 are enumerated below.

settings of tagef-bawif:
DRUIX_HOST=druix.zemvarlabs.internal
DRUIX_PORT=8000